Hair testing is recognized as an effective means for detecting substance use. It provides a comprehensive historical record of alcohol and drug intake by capturing biomarkers within the growing hair strand. If collected near the scalp, hair can reveal drug and alcohol consumption over roughly a three-month duration. This method is straightforward in terms of collection, challenging to tamper with, and convenient to transport.
A sample of 1.5 inches, consisting of approximately 200 hair strands (resembling the thickness of a number 2 pencil) near the scalp, yields the ideal 100mg amount for analysis and confirmation purposes. For tests involving EtG, additional substances, or exceeding 10 panels, a 150mg sample is preferable. The sample should ideally be measured on a jeweler’s scale. Should scalp hair be inaccessible, a comparable portion of body hair may be gathered. The term "head hair" specifically refers to scalp hair, while "body hair" encompasses all other hair types (e.g., facial, axillary).
Process Overview
The key stages in the lab processing of a drug test result encompass Accessioning, Screening, Extraction, and Confirmation.
Accessioning involves incorporating a sample into the lab systems. This step includes ensuring the sample is sealed and dispatched correctly, assigning a distinct LAN (Laboratory Accessioning Number), and completing any further data entry absent in an electronic chain of custody.
Screening is a preliminary swift assessment for any drugs of abuse. It serves as a cost-efficient method to dismiss drug use in most samples, however, positive results require confirmation for legal acceptability. Samples indicating drug presence after screening necessitate a subsequent confirmation.
During the Extraction phase, should a screen indicate drug presence, further hair is allocated for processing. Hair drug screening demands drugs to be extracted at significantly lower concentrations than alternate methods (e.g., urine or oral fluid), making it a notably challenging technique.
Confirmation of positive results occurs via GC/MS, GC/MS/MS, or LC/MS/MS. If needed, samples indicating drug presence are cleansed before confirmation. Every step from Accessioning to Confirmation is evaluated in compliance with CAP (College of American Pathologists) Hair designation and ISO / IEC 17025 accreditation.

Note: While commonly labeled as "hair follicle tests", the methodology assesses the hair strand, not the follicle beneath the scalp.

With its multidisciplinary nature, hair testing brings together researchers, scientists, and experts from various domains to develop innovative techniques, explore new methodologies, and address emerging concerns, responding to the ever-evolving challenges of drug abuse, therapeutic drug monitoring, and environmental exposures to pollutants.
The joint meeting of the Society of Hair Testing (SoHT) and the Italian Group of Forensic Toxicologists (GTFI) was organized in Verona, June 8–10, 2022, and hosted by the Legal Medicine team of the Verona University Hospital, directed by Franco Tagliaro together with Federica Bortolotti and Rossella Gottardo.
It served as a prominent platform for knowledge exchange and collaboration, facilitating groundbreaking advancements in hair testing and analysis. In this special issue of Drug Testing and Analysis, we aim to showcase the remarkable manuscripts presented at this significant event, shedding light on the latest research and highlighting the future directions in this field.
Novel Analytical Techniques: The Verona meeting witnessed the unveiling of cutting-edge analytical techniques, offering enhanced sensitivity, selectivity, and accuracy for drug testing. Remarkable advancements in sample preparation, detection, and identification of drug compounds have been presented. The manuscripts in this section presented novel approaches, such as multianalyte methods and on-line preparation which can enable rapid analysis and improve thorough forensic investigations.
Biomarkers and Pharmacokinetics: The identification and validation of reliable biomarkers and pharmacokinetic studies are fundamental aspects of drug testing and analysis. The impact of hair treatments on the oxidation/decomposition of drugs in hair was also explored, as the long-term fate of drugs incorporated in the keratin matrix. Furthermore, the SoHT meeting in Verona featured research on the identification and quantification of alcohol abuse biomarkers, their stability, and their correlation with exposure and other biomarkers.
Forensic Applications and Interpretation: One of the vital objectives of hair testing is its application in forensic investigations and legal proceedings. The SoHT meeting in Verona emphasized the significance of rigorous interpretation of analytical results and the need for standardized protocols. Manuscripts in this section present advancements in forensic toxicology, and have explored the challenges posed by emerging designer drugs and strategies to combat their proliferation. The pitfalls encountered when the exogenous/endogenous nature of a substance is questioned were presented and discussed. The special issue presents also manuscripts that delve into the ethical implications of drug testing in drug facilitated sexual assaults.
Clinical Applications of hair testing are witnessed by the insight on environmental tobacco smoke exposure, assessed by hair analysis in a population of students and the study of in utero-exposure to drugs of abuse through neonatal hair analysis. Exposure to drugs was also important in cases of child abuse/neglect, when the clinical purpose of hair testing merge with its forensic applications.
The legal framework surrounding hair testing and the achievement of guidelines to ensure fairness, accuracy, and confidentiality in drug testing practices have also been discussed,and the SoHT consensus on general hair testing and testing for drugs of abuse was presented at the meeting and published as a Letter to the Editor.
